LXM05A交流伺服驱动装置-定位范围与软件限位开关

需积分: 47 2 下载量 165 浏览量 更新于2024-08-06 收藏 2.06MB PDF 举报
"该文档是关于Unix环境高级编程的,主要讨论了定位范围相关的概念和技术,特别是针对一种交流伺服驱动装置LXM05A。文档详细介绍了如何在不同运行模式下处理定位极限,以及如何使用软件限位开关来扩展和监控定位范围。此外,它还提到了参数设置,如SPVswLimPusr和SPVswLimNusr,用于设定软件开关的正向和反向位置极限。文档强调了安全操作的重要性,警告在没有适当安全装置的情况下,不应让人进入驱动装置的危险区域。" 在Unix环境的高级编程中,定位范围是一个关键概念,特别是在控制系统如伺服驱动装置的操作中。这个文档详细阐述了定位范围在不同运行模式下的行为,例如点到点运行模式,其中电机可能超出其物理定位极限,导致基准点丢失。在这种情况下,系统会自动设定尺寸为0以防止进一步的超出范围操作。 软件限位开关是一种软件层面的机制,可以在电机具有有效零点(ref_ok = 1)时提供定位范围的监控。通过参数SPVswLimPusr和SPVswLimNusr,用户可以设置软件开关的正向和反向位置极限,这些极限值可以是相对于零点的位置值。一旦设置,这些软件限位开关可以通过参数SPV_SW_Limits激活。位置调节器的位置决定了电机何时会停止以防止触发限位开关。参数_SigLatched的Bit 2用于报告软件限位开关是否已被触发。 文档还涉及到具体的参数设置,如INT32类型的SPVswLimPusr和SPVswLimNusr,它们的读写属性、默认值以及对应的通信协议如CANopen和Modbus的寄存器地址。这些参数的配置对于确保驱动装置的安全和正确运行至关重要。 同时,文档提醒用户,尽管驱动系统设计有安全措施,但若不配合适当的辅助安全装置,仍可能存在人身安全风险。因此,操作人员必须具备相应的资质,设备应按规定的用途使用,且在没有适当保护的情况下,不应允许人员进入潜在的危险区域。 这个文档提供了丰富的技术细节,包括伺服驱动装置的机械和电气参数,以及安全功能的描述,为Unix环境中的高级编程提供了深入的理解,特别是在控制系统的安全操作和优化方面。